WebMay 26, 2024 · To maintain a pure culture or to obtain a pure culture of a microorganism, a quadrant/T/isolation/streak plate is performed. The T-streak is a form of dilutions on a solid surface (Franklund, 2024). In this technique, the plate is divided into sections. Bacteria are deposited in the first section at full strength from the original source.

WebFeb 11, 2008 · See answers (2) Best Answer. Copy. A mixed culture is a container that holds two or more identified and easily differentiated species of microorganisms. A contaminated culture was once pure or mixed (and thus a known entity) but since had contaminants (unwanted microbes of uncertain identity) introduced into it.
